There was once a time when the only way people could darken their skin was by subjecting themselves to that big yellow star in the sky, but today (with the use of DHA) it's possible to safely dye the skin and have the tan you've always dreamed about.

You can buy bottles of creams, lotions, mouses, gels, and sprays from the store, or you can opt to have someone else apply your synthetic tan for you. For those people who are afraid of turning themselves into an unnatural color, it might be wise for you to visit someone who has experience with airbrushing. Airbrushed tans tend to look more like the real thing and having someone spray it on you can help you avoid any mistakes.

It's not possible to get a tan in a bed or by laying out in the sun without damaging your skin. It simply cannot be done. When you see a person who was once white, go from that color to a much darker shade, you're witnessing the body's way of attempting to defend its largest organ against structural damage.
